Scope and Contents From the Series:

Material from Everett Pope’s time in the US Marine Corps can be found in the Military Service series (1939-2011). Much of the series is photocopies obtained by Laurence Pope while researching his father’s role in the Peleliu landing during the second world war, including operational reports, correspondence, and military personnel files.

Scope and Contents From the Series:

The Writings & Research Files series (2000-2012) consists of Laurence Pope’s personal topical files on early modern European subjects such as Nathaniel Hooke’s family and François de Callières. The series contains photoduplicates of eighteenth-century documents pertaining to the Hooke family and other research topics as well as published writings and reviews.
